Abstract
A unified topology of the shunt APF and its mathematic model are proposed in this paper. Based on these works, hysteresis current control strategies in a-b-c coordinates and in coordinates for the three-phase four-wire shunt APF are investigated and compared. Several conclusions are obtained and their validity are proved by simulation results. The analyses in this paper offer a significant theory basis for improving compensation capability of the three-phase four-wire active power filters with the helps of hysteresis current control strategy.
